Harry: php5: sonderzeichen problem bei mysql

Beitrag lesen

Holladiewaldfee,

also, wenn sein Provider wirklich die neueste MySQL-Version, sprich die 4.1.7 installiert hat, dann muß er noch ein paar Sachen anders machen.

Erstens sollte er von mysql_* auf mysqli umsatteln.
Zweitens sollte er sich mit der neuen Fähigkeit von MySQL auseinandersetzen, verschiedene Zeichensätze zu verwenden. Die werden mit einer Query der Art

SET CHARACTER SET "XXX"

gesetzt, wobei XXX der Zeichensatz ist. Ich verwende latin1, er kann aber natürlich auch utf8 oder sonstwas hernehmen. Wichtig ist, daß er drauf achtet, daß die Tabelle und die Verbindung den gleichen Zeichensatz verwenden, sonst kommt es zu solchen Spielchen wie "?" statt Sonderzeichen usw.

(Viel) mehr dazu auch unter http://dev.mysql.com/doc/mysql/en/Charset.html.

Ciao,

Harry

--
  Irgendwann kommt die Waldfee - oder auch nicht ... (Projektphase: Keine Ahnung)
  Bis dahin:
  Ski- und Bergtouren in den Tölzer Voralpen und im Karwendel